What You'll Do
- Perform and ensure proper completion of all avionics activities as assigned by management
- Test, troubleshoot, and repair aircraft electrical systems and equipment
- Test, troubleshoot, repair, install and inspect aircraft electronic systems and components including communications, navigation, and autoflight equipment
- Inspect and test aircraft instrument, electrical and avionics systems
- Ensure aircraft documentation is complete and accurate
- Ensure that all components installed on aircraft are properly certified
- Carry out duties as per the appropriate Aircraft Maintenance manuals and ensure conformity to Transport Canada regulatory standards
- Attend training courses as required by management and adhere to all safety policies and procedures
- Maintain a clean and safe work environment at all times
- Occasionally will be assigned "M" related hands-on duties such as disassembling aircraft systems, removal of defective components and installing replacement parts, components and structures
- Perform any other duties and responsibilities as assigned
What You Bring
- A valid Transport Canada "E" license is required
- Experienced with troubleshooting and repairing Avionics components and associated aircraft systems
- Experience in aircraft periodic inspections and heavy inspections
- Must be able to read, understand and interpret technical publications, maintenance manuals, service bulletins, technical drawings and blueprints
- Solid knowledge of aircraft systems, aerodynamics, aircraft structures and basic applied mechanics will be considered an asset.
- Demonstrated experience performing a large variety of tasks relating to many aspects of aircraft maintenance
- A highly self-motivated individual with excellent organizational and communication skills
- Ability to be an effective team player with strong interpersonal skills, able to work with a diverse team
- Strong judgement and problem solving skills with ability to apply to the work
- 5-5-4 schedule flexible to work overtime and weekends
- Must qualify for a RAIC and AVOP passes
- Ontario driver's license with a clean abstract
- Ability to lift up to 50 pounds
- Occasional travel may be required
